  • 2012 Ford Focus Electric Priced at $39,200
    Ford Motor Co. announced Wednesday its new all-electric 2012 Ford Focus Electric will start at $39,200, plus an additional $795 for destination charges. Including the $7,500 federal tax credit for which the Ford Focus Electric will be fully eligible, the consumer’s after-tax net value of the vehicle will be $32,495.   • Ford Focus Electric to Come with Household Solar Panel Option
    Ford is teaming with solar panel maker SunPower to provide a high-efficiency rooftop solar system that will provide Ford Focus Electric owners enough renewable energy production to offset the energy used for charging.   • 2012 Ford Focus Electric Gets Advanced Radiator
    The 2012 Ford Focus Electric will get an unique liquid-cooled battery system that cools the lithium-ion battery and keeps it working at its prime, even in the hottest of conditions.   • AT&T to Provide Wireless Connectivity to Ford Focus Electric
    Ford has chosen communications giant AT&T as the provider of wireless connectivity for its first all-electric passenger car -the Ford Focus Electric.   • Ford Focus Electric Wins Green Car Vision Award
    The Green Car Journal announced that the Ford Focus Electric won the annual Green Car Vision Award at the Washington Auto Show. This year, Green Car Vision Award finalists included the Ford Focus Electric, Honda Fit EV, Mitsubishi i, Toyota RAV4 Electric, and Volvo C30 DrivE electric.   • Best Buy to Charge Up Ford Electric Focus
    To help with the charging infrastructure, Ford has partnered with Best Buy to install home charging stations for its all-new Ford Focus Electric, costing about US$1,500 each.
